How To Retrieve Blocked Messages Iphone Unfortunately, the answer is NO. You cannot retrieve blocked messages on your iPhone. After blocking someone, you’ll not be able to receive phone calls and messages from them. iPhones, unlike Android phones, don’t have a blocked folder for data recovery.

How do I see blocked messages on iPhone? To see the phone numbers, contacts, and email addresses that you’ve blocked from Phone, FaceTime, Messages, or Mail:
Phone. Go to Settings > Phone and tap Blocked Contacts to see the list.
FaceTime. Go to Settings > FaceTime. .
Messages. Go to Settings > Messages. .
Mail. Go to Settings > Mail.

What do blocked callers hear iPhone?
When calling from the blocked number, the caller hears either one ring, or no rings at all, but the other phone remains silent. The caller is then informed that the recipient isn’t available, and is diverted to voicemail (if that service is set up by the person you’re calling).

Will blocked messages come through when unblocked?
Text messages (SMS, MMS, iMessage) from blocked contacts (numbers or email addresses) do not appear anywhere on your device. Unblocking the contact does NOT show any messages sent to you when it was blocked. Do you know what happens on the blocked number’s end?

Can you send a text to someone you blocked?
The block works in one direction only – meaning that the blocked person is unable to call/message you, but you will still have the option to call/message them.
